The selecting criteria are a mystery though. Let me illustrate – I brought a box with about 40 pieces of kid’s clothing, 37 of which had the original price tags on, the used ones were brand names, mentioned as “favorite”. 5 made the cut. While browsing, I found way more worn out clothing on the racks. Another peculiarity all dresses size up to 36 months, I believe, must have bloomers. As I find the bloomers extremely ugly not to mention uncomfortable with the elastic running around the thighs, I never buy dresses that have them. So they turned down several dresses with Nordstrom tags on. I think you get a fair price as opposed to just donating stuff at “Good will” (which is located very close by so you can conveniently get rid of the things that did not make the selection). The store is organized by size and style (size 2T, size 3T, girls, boys, long pants, shorts, dresses…) and it makes it a breeze to browse. The staff is friendly, well trained and makes the experience pleasant. I would definitely visit again. Read more
